Purfleet to Alfreton by train

Planning a train journey from Purfleet to Alfreton? The trip usually takes about 4hrs 9 mins, covering approximately 131 miles (210 kilometres). With roughly 25 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£21.50,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

What are my cheap ticket options for Purfleet to Alfreton journeys?

From booking in Advance, to our FairSplits, here are our tips for you to find the best price

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Purfleet to Alfreton start from as little as £21.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Purfleet to Alfreton start from £101.30 one way, or £105.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Purfleet to Alfreton are available for £146.50 one way, or £287.30 return

Facilities That Make Your Journey Comfortable

Step into Purfleet station and you'll find a variety of conveniences designed to ease your travels. The ticket office opens early at 06:15 and closes by 09:50 on weekdays, ensuring you can get your tickets with ease before starting your day. With ticket machines available, you can quickly collect tickets bought online, facilitated by accessible ticket machines and supportive induction loops for those with impairments. If you're using smartcards, validators are present to make your transit smooth and efficient.

While the station lacks amenities like wheelchairs or accessible toilets, it offers step-free access across the platforms, making it user-friendly for those with mobility considerations. In terms of accessibility, ramps ensure easy access to trains, and the presence of customer help points means assistance is never far away should you need it. Despite missing some facilities, Purfleet Station focuses on ensuring a practical and straightforward journey.

Transport Links To Ease Your Travel

When it comes to hopping on after your train journey, transportation options near Purfleet Station have you covered. Rail replacement services are available, serving crucial routes toward Barking, Grays, and Tilbury, with convenient stops at Purfleet General Stores for both directions. This makes contingency journey planning seamless. For those interested in further exploring the broader area, information on local buses is accessible, with details provided here. Even though there's no cycle hire, the station does offer ample bicycle storage spaces for those who prefer to pedal.

Station Facilities

The station offers a variety of facilities aimed at making your travel experience as comfortable as possible. At the Ticket Office, open Monday through Saturday from 06:45 to 18:00 and Sunday from 10:30 to 18:00, you can buy tickets or collect those purchased online. The station features accessible ticket machines and a helpful induction loop for those with hearing aids. CCTV surveillance guarantees safety throughout the station.

Alfreton Station is equipped with customer information screens and announcements to keep you well-informed on travel updates. If you lose anything during your journey, the EMR lost property office in Nottingham will keep items for up to three months.

Accessibility

While the station offers step-free access to the northbound platform and ticket office, the southbound platform is not fully accessible. For specific needs, travelers can contact the helpline to secure assistance. Additional facilities include sheltered platforms, seating, and an inside waiting area located within the booking office, making sure comfort does not take a back seat.

Transport Connections

Alfreton Station is well-connected by various modes of transport. Rail replacement services conveniently pick up and drop off in the station forecourt. For local traveling, consider calling one of the available taxi providers such as Bretts or Royal Cabs, the latter offering wheelchair-friendly options. Additionally, printable bus information provides an easy guide for planning onward travel.
